MUSHROOM ANTIPASTO SALAD

Categories     Vegetable

Time 10m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

400 g button mushrooms
2/3 cup olive oil
1/3 cup red wine vinegar
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on caster sugar
salt & fresh ground pepper
200 g kalamata olives
200 g semi-dried tomatoes
200 g char-grilled eggplants, slices
1 cup small basil leaves

Steps:

  • Place mushrooms in a large bowl.
  • Combine oil, vinegar, mustard, sugar and salt and pepper in a screw-top jar.
  • Shake well to combine.
  • Pour dressing over mushrooms and toss well to coat mushrooms in mixture.
  • Cover and set aside for 30 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es.
  • Just before serving add remaining ingredients and toss gently to combine.
